Understanding the Nutritional Needs of Healthy Cats and Those with Diet-Sensitive Conditions

Vet Clin North Am Small Anim Pract. 2020 Sep;50(5):905-924. doi: 10.1016/j.cvsm.2020.05.001. Epub 2020 Jul 6.

Abstract

Diets for cats must provide complete nutrition and meet the needs of the individual patient. There is no single diet that is perfect for all cats, and veterinarians must consider the needs of the cat as well as the preferences of the owners when making dietary recommendations. This article focuses on the interface between animal factors and nutritional needs in cats and is divided into 3 sections. Section 1 addresses the dietary needs of healthy cats, including differences among life stages. Section 2 addresses common myths regarding feline nutrition. Section 3 addresses common nutrient-sensitive conditions in cats, including sarcopenia of aging.
